Police in Turkey force ousted opposition out of headquarters as crisis deepens

Turkish riot police fired tear gas and forced their way into the main opposition partyโ€™s headquarters to evict its ousted leadership on Sunday, fuelling a crisis at the heart of Turkeyโ€™s democracy. Clouds of tear gas billowed within the Republican Peopleโ€™s Party (CHP) building while those inside shouted and threw objects at the entrance as police โ€Œbroke through a makeshift barricade.
